How much does hiring a programming tutor cost?

The cost of hiring a programming tutor can vary widely based on factors such as their experience, location, and the complexity of the subject matter. On average, rates can range from $20 to $100 per hour. More experienced tutors or those specializing in niche areas may charge higher rates due to their expertise. Many tutoring platforms also offer package deals or discounts for multiple sessions, making it easier to find an option that fits your budget.

For adult and senior learners, specialized programming tutors often focus on teaching basic computer skills alongside introductory programming concepts. These tutors typically charge between $50 to $85 per hour, with some offering discounted rates for first sessions or multi-hour packages. They often cover topics such as using smartphones and tablets, navigating the internet, setting up email accounts, and basic coding concepts. These tutors are trained to work at a pace comfortable for older adults, ensuring a supportive and patient learning environment that addresses the unique challenges faced by senior learners in the digital age.

How do tutoring sessions typically work?

Tutoring sessions typically follow a structured format designed to maximize learning and engagement. At the beginning of each session, tutors often invest time in building a rapport with their students, which helps create a comfortable learning environment. The tutor introduces the session’s objectives and engages the student with relevant questions to activate prior knowledge. The core of the session usually involves a mini-lesson where the tutor models concepts or skills, followed by independent practice where students can apply what they’ve learned with guidance as needed.

As sessions progress, tutors focus on empowering students to become independent learners. They encourage critical thinking and problem-solving rather than simply re-teaching material. Sessions often conclude with a formative assessment, such as an exit ticket, to evaluate the student’s grasp of the topic. This structured approach not only helps students understand the material but also fosters confidence in their abilities, making it clear that mistakes are part of the learning process. Overall, tutoring sessions aim to be interactive and supportive, adapting to each student's unique needs and learning style.

What qualifications should I look for in a tutor?

Look for tutors with relevant educational backgrounds, such as degrees in computer science or related fields, and experience in teaching programming languages or concepts. Many platforms vet their tutors to ensure they have the necessary skills and expertise. Additionally, it’s beneficial to find a tutor who has experience working with adult learners or seniors, as they may employ different teaching methods that cater to varied learning styles and paces.

Tutors experienced in adult education often understand the unique challenges that older learners might face, such as technology apprehension or time constraints due to work and family commitments. They can create a supportive learning environment that fosters confidence and encourages engagement, making the learning process more enjoyable and effective for adults and seniors alike.

What programming languages can I learn with a tutor?

Tutors typically offer instruction in a variety of programming languages, including Python, Java, C++, JavaScript, and Ruby. Each language has its unique applications, so it’s beneficial to choose one that aligns with your interests or career goals. For instance, Python is great for data science and machine learning, while JavaScript is essential for web development.

When selecting a tutor, be sure to communicate your specific interests or projects. This will help them tailor the lessons to your needs, ensuring that you gain relevant skills and practical experience. A good tutor will also guide you on best practices and resources to further enhance your learning outside of sessions.

What questions should I ask a computer programming tutor?

When considering hiring a computer programming tutor, here are some key questions you should ask:

  • What programming languages and technologies do you specialize in? Tutors often have expertise in specific languages like Python, Java, C++, or JavaScript. Ensure their skills align with your learning goals or course requirements.
  • What is your teaching experience and background? Look for tutors with relevant educational qualifications in computer science or related fields, as well as experience teaching programming concepts. Those with industry experience can often provide practical insights.
  • How do you typically structure tutoring sessions? Effective tutors usually have a structured approach, starting with assessing your current knowledge, setting clear learning objectives, and using a mix of explanation, demonstration, and hands-on practice. They should be able to adapt their teaching style to your learning pace and preferences.
  • Can you provide examples of how you explain complex programming concepts? A good tutor should be able to break down difficult ideas into simpler, more digestible parts. Ask for specific examples of how they would explain topics like object-oriented programming, algorithms, or data structures.
  • How do you help students debug code and solve programming problems? Debugging is a crucial skill in programming. Tutors should guide you through the problem-solving process rather than simply providing solutions, helping you develop critical thinking and troubleshooting skills.
  • Do you assign homework or projects between sessions? Many tutors provide additional exercises or mini-projects to reinforce learning. This can be particularly helpful for skill development and practical application of concepts.
